Ingredients
For the Base
- 3 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il
- 1 cup diced yellow onion
- 3/4 cup grated carrots
- 1/2 cup thinly sliced or finely chopped celery
- 2 large garlic cloves, minced (about 2-3 teaspoons)
For Flavor
- 1/2 cup dry white apple vinegar (such as pinot grigio)
- 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 4 cups chicken broth or stock (use low sodium for easier salt control)
- 2 cups half-and-half, warmed
- 1-2 teaspoons fresh thyme leaves, chopped
- 1/2 teaspoon dried Italian herb blend
For the Soup
- 1 pound gnocchi (either refrigerated or shelf-stable)
- 1/2 to 3/4 cup shredded parmigiano reggiano
- 2 cups cooked rotisserie chicken breast, shredded or cubed
- 2 cups fresh spinach, roughly chopped
- 1/8 teaspoon freshly grated nutmeg (optional)
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
Servings: 4
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 25 minutes
Total Time: 35 minutes
How to Make Tasty Rotisserie Chicken Gnocchi Soup
Step 1: Sauté Vegetables
Start by heating the butter and ol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Once melted:
* Add diced onion, grated carrots, and celery.
* Sauté until vegetables are softened, about 5 minutes.
* Stir in minced gar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
Step 2: Create the Base
Next, create a flavorful base:
* Pour in the dry white apple vinegar while scraping any bits off the bottom of the pot.
* Sprinkle in flour and stir well to combine. Cook for about 2 minutes.
Step 3: Add Broth and Cream
Now it’s time to add richness:
* Gradually whisk in chicken broth until smooth.
* Stir in warmed half-and-half.
* Bring to a simmer before adding thyme leaves and dried Italian herb blend.
Step 4: Incorporate Gnocchi and Chicken
Add your main ingredients:
* Stir in gnocchi along with shredded rotisserie chicken.
* Simmer for about 5–7 minutes until gnocchi is cooked through.
Step 5: Finish with Spinach
Finally, bring in some greens:
* Add chopped spinach into the soup just before serving.
* Season with nutmeg (if using), salt, and pepper to taste.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Making Tasty Rotisserie Chicken Gnocchi Soup can be easy, but there are common pitfalls that can affect the final dish. Here are some mistakes to watch out for:
- Ignoring Ingredient Quality: Using low-quality broth or old vegetables can lead to a bland soup. Always opt for fresh ingredients and good-quality chicken broth.
- Overcooking Gnocchi: Cook gnocchi until they float; overcooking makes them mushy. Follow package instructions closely and add them in the last few minutes of cooking.
- Skipping Seasoning Adjustments: Not tasting as you go can result in bland flavors. Adjust salt, pepper, and herbs according to your preference throughout the cooking process.
- Not Thinning the Soup Properly: If your soup is too thick, it might not have the right consistency. Add more chicken broth or half-and-half gradually until desired thickness is achieved.
- Neglecting Fresh Herbs: Fresh herbs add brightness and flavor. Don’t skip them; add them towards the end of cooking for the best flavor impact.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- item Store soup in an airtight container.
- item It will last for up to 3 days in the fridge.
Freezing Tasty Rotisserie Chicken Gnocchi Soup
- item Use a freezer-safe container or bag.
- item The soup can be frozen for up to 3 months.
Reheating Tasty Rotisserie Chicken Gnocchi Soup
- item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C), place soup in an oven-safe dish, cover with foil, and heat for about 20-25 minutes.
- item Microwave: Heat in a microwave-safe bowl on high for 2-3 minutes, stirring halfway through.
- item Stovetop: Pour into a saucepan over medium heat and stir until warmed through, about 5-10 minutes.
